Final stats:
Warriors:
45.7% shooting (43/94 FGs), 24/56 threes, 14/17 FTs
47 rebounds (16 off.), 34 assists, 21 turnovers, 14 steals, 5 blocks
Pelicans:
45.2% shooting (38/84 FGs), 8/29 threes, 22/29 FTs
45 rebounds (15 off.), 22 assists, 20 turnovers, 11 steals, 4 blocks
Points in paint:
Warriors: 36
Pelicans: 56
Fastbreak points:
Warriors: 21
Pelicans: 14
Points off turnovers:
Warriors: 27
Pelicans: 20
Bench points:
Warriors: 48
Pelicans: 43
